Output 96ba0877e19b6c53a2d904147dad40a7f6805042375259eacd586af842021e72:1

value
6258884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9531cf03bfd83cc6cc35675fd8a4f539ccf8e289 OP_EQUAL
address
3FHtGthhjneJJFqGMq3b51DiET2mvXAdBN
transaction
96ba0877e19b6c53a2d904147dad40a7f6805042375259eacd586af842021e72
spent
true